Stevenson School is a PK-12 co-educational, college-preparatory, boarding and day school with enrollment of 770 students on two campuses in beautiful Central Coast California. The Upper Division campus (Grades 9-12) is located in Pebble Beach. The Lower/Middle Campus (Grades PK-8) is in nearby Carmel-by-the-Sea. Stevenson is a mission driven school that aims to help students shape joyful lives while instilling a passion for learning and achievement to prepare them for success in school and beyond. The core values of the community are safety, trust, respect, belonging, and inclusion.

Stevenson School seeks an Administrative Assistant to the Dean’s Office to start January 2023. Reporting to the dean of students, the administrative assistant (AADO) is responsible for a range of administrative and logistical duties that ensure the accurate, and consistent operation and swift responsiveness of the dean of students’ team. The AADO plays a critical role in ensuring student safety with timely tracking of student attendance and serves as a nodal point for community updates and reliable information.

The ideal candidate will be exceptionally organized and detail-oriented, and demonstrate the ability to effectively manage multiple tasks simultaneously, while maintaining a positive attitude and enthusiasm to engage with all members of the School community. Stevenson’s student body is richly diverse in makeup with upper division boarding students hailing from 15 states and 23 countries. The AADO will regularly interact directly with students and their families and will be expected to exercise cultural competency at all times. The assistant will also on occasion have access to confidential student-related information. A steadfast commitment to discretion and confidentiality is a must.

This is a full-time, 12-month/year position with significant project work each summer to prepare for the school year ahead. Occasional evening and/or weekend support of events and programs will be necessary.

Responsibilities:

  • Greet and appropriately direct callers and visitors
  • Respond to email and other correspondence in a timely manner and in accordance with school policies and expectations
  • Accurately track daily attendance, collaborating with teaching faculty for timely submission of attendance information
  • Follow up on unexcused absences with parents and dorm faculty
  • Provide database support to the dean’s office; design and distribute forms, surveys, and queries using the school’s student information system (Slate), and maintain data integrity for student contact information
  • Manage the residential weekend and vacation pass system in partnership with the director of resident life
  • Edit and distribute the weekly bulletin, and support the director of activities with distribution of the assembly digest
  • Maintain the student life database including day students’ vehicular data
  • Issue student parking permits
  • Manage the dean of students’ Google calendar and the Pebble Beach campus activities calendar
  • Produce and communicate the weekend activities schedule in coordination with the resident activities committee, the director of activities, and dorm heads
  • Serve as liaison with FLIK, the school’s food service provider
  • Other duties as assigned
